A spark of hope

The kindness in my eyes was nothing to match the pain in hers
Somewhere deep down the darkness stirs
It calls to her like a telephone
Her tears inside, shed love to disown
To let the tears roll down her cheeks, would bring pure ecstasy
She cries out, almost breathlessly
"Save me now, save me from the blackness or I'll never be able to go back..."
Something rose up in the black
A single flame
To show her where her heart should aim...
